Qualifications
* Hold a relevant degree in Environmental Health or equivalent or be able to demonstrate an equivalent level of relevant experience in the private sector housing field.
* Hold a HHSRS competency/practitioners' qualification.
* Have at least 3 years' experience of working within a local housing authority or housing related field or similar.
* Be experienced in inspecting and licensing HMOs, investigating complaints about property conditions, assessing properties in accordance with HHSRS and carrying out inspections under the Housing Act 2004.
* Have good knowledge of the Housing Act 2004 and other relevant housing legislation and understand national and local housing priorities.
* Be able to prepare schedule of works, draft and serve statutory housing enforcement notices, produce witness statements, legal case files to attend court and tribunals to give evidence.
* Have experience of serving enforcement notices and attending Tribunals/Magistrates Court.
* Have experience of serving Civil Penalties.
